Single Bed Mattress

A single bed mattress is designed to accommodate one person. They are often used in guest rooms or by couples who don't wish to share a bed.

The mattresses measure 39 inches by 75 inches, approximately 5 inches shorter than a twin mattress. These mattresses are great for children and people with short legs.

Durability

Although the life expectancy of a mattress could vary depending on its use the majority of mattresses last between 8 and 10 years. It may be time to replace your mattress if it's over eight years old.

Listening to your body is the best way to determine whether it's time to get a new mattress. If you're having trouble sleeping on your mattress, or are experiencing new pains in the morning, it's an appropriate time to replace your mattress.

If you're thinking of buying a new mattress, take into account factors like convenience and price. You can buy a mattress at brick-and-mortar stores or on the internet.

Buying online is more convenient because it eliminates the need for face-to-face interactions with salespeople and doesn't require you to visit physical stores. Plus, most websites have explicit specifications for the product and images shoppers can use to compare various models and brands.

Another benefit of shopping online is that it typically costs less than shopping in-store. In addition to saving money, online mattress single sale stores typically offer free shipping on items that qualify for free ground delivery.

There are numerous warranties you can choose from, both online and brick-and-mortar. They cover any defect in the mattress for a predetermined period of time. The majority of manufacturers guarantee that the mattress will not be defective at the time of purchase and they'll repair or replace it at no extra cost to you.

A warranty covers a range of problems such as excessive sagging or damaged coils. These issues can negatively affect comfort and support. It may also cover manufacturing issues related to the mattress cover.

Durability is mostly dependent on the way the mattress is constructed, with the most durable mattresses using premium base foams, or pocket coils. These products are designed to resist wear and tear and will last for a long time.

The thickness of the mattress's base layer can affect its durability as well. Mattresses with a thicker base layer are more likely to develop soft spots or other snags through the years.

If you're looking for a comfy solid, durable, and supportive mattress that can endure years of use, you should consider a quality memory foam model with a thicker base layer. A 12-inch-thick, high-quality memory foam mattress is expected to last 10 to 15 years.
